Top Compatible Ebook Formats in 2026
- AZW3 (Kindle Format 8): The most advanced format designed specifically for Kindle devices, supporting complex formatting, images, and annotations.
- MOBI: An earlier format still supported by Kindle, compatible with most e-books and capable of handling rich formatting.
- KFX: Amazon’s latest proprietary format offering enhanced typography, layout, and support for fixed-layout content.
- PDF: Widely used, but often less optimized for Kindle screens; best for documents with fixed layouts.
- Plain Text (.txt): Basic format suitable for simple text content, though lacking formatting and images.
Formats to Avoid in 2026
- EPUB: Not natively supported on Kindle devices, requiring conversion which may affect formatting.
- DOCX or DOC: Word document formats need conversion and may not preserve layout or images.
- CBZ/CBR: Comic book formats, incompatible without conversion.
Recommended Conversion Tools
If you have e-books in unsupported formats, several tools can convert them to Kindle-compatible formats. Popular options include Calibre, Kindle Previewer, and online converters, ensuring your library remains accessible and well-formatted on your device.
